While reading an interview about it there was mention of the advance in effects. Not sure of the details but I think it was comparing the old cloaking field while the Predator stood still to a shot where a pred cloaks or de-cloaks while jumping a chasm.

Edit: Just realised some people may talk of it shamelessly mixing two franchises. There is a precedent. In Predator 2 while Danny Glover is in the Predator ship he sees a trophy rack. One of the skulls is obviously an Alien. I'm not talking of an alien skull similar to an ALiens, this is 100% and described even by the films makers as an Aliens skull.
